JABRA LAUNCHES INDUSTRY-FIRST IN-CAR SPEAKERPHONE WITH THREE SPEAKERS

Jabra FREEWAY provides virtual surround sound, noise-cancelling and voice activation

Sydney, AUSTRALIA – 14 March 2011– Jabra has launched an industry-first innovation in the speakerphone category, with the market’s first three-speaker system. The revolutionary new Jabra FREEWAY provides high-quality audio output and includes virtual surround sound and noise-cancelling functionality.

The Jabra FREEWAY brings unique features to the in-car speakerphone category, while addressing consumers’ need for easy-to-use, high-quality hands-free devices when driving. In addition to the advanced three-speaker design, full stereo audio and virtual surround sound, the Jabra FREEWAY includes a dual microphone system to reduce road, wind and other background noise, enabling exceptionally clear communication.

The Jabra FREEWAY enables users to make or receive calls just by using their voice, enabling completely hands-free communication. It also includes a built-in motion sensor for simple, hands-free use, automatically turning the in-car speakerphone on or off when the car door is opened or closed.

The Jabra FREEWAY’s Advanced Voice Guidance capability communicates pairing instructions and status updates to users to enable quick and easy setup. In addition, A2DP Wireless Streaming allows users to play music and audio from GPS applications or smartphones wirelessly through the car radio. Advanced Multi-use™ permits two active Bluetooth® connections simultaneously, with the ability to switch between them freely.

Key Specifications of the Jabra FREEWAY in-car speakerphone include: • Rich and crisp stereo sound with three speakers and Virtual Surround Sound • Dual Microphones for outstanding background noise reduction • Bluetooth 2.1 Technology, including EDR, eSCO, A2DP, AVRCP and PBAP • Voice Control functionality to make, answer, redial and reject calls • Voice Guidance for easy setup and operation and to announce the incoming caller’s name. • Automatic on/off functionality with built-in motion sensor • A2DP Wireless Streaming for playback of music, audio and podcasts from GPS applications and smartphones • HD Voice Ready • No installation – just clip onto the sun visor and go • Two chargers included – USB and universal car lighter charger • Up to 14 hours talk time and up to 40 days of standby time • Weighs 150 grams • Dimensions – 99mm x 120mm x 19mm.

The Jabra FREEWAY is available from mid-March at the recommended retail price of AUD$149 including GST from Dick Smith Electronics, Harvey Norman, JB-Hi Fi and other leading retailers.
